The NiSi Cinema 4×5.65″ Nano IR Neutral Density 0.9 Filter (3 Stops) creates a darkening of the entire image by 3 stops, allowing you to compensate for bright conditions whilst keeping your Aperture, Shutter speed and iso where you need them to be. The IR Coating eliminates any unwanted coloration of the image when used in conjunction with other filters. In order to remove any color cast and keep the Blacks as rich and true as possible, one layer of NiSi Optical Nano Coating is applied to each of this filter’s surfaces along with the IR coating to provide the highest color accuracy as possible. This coating, coupled with high-quality optical glass and strict manufacturing standards, give you accurate color, extreme sharpness making it perfect for today’s high-res. cameras.

The NiSi 4 x 5.65” Range is compatible with all leading brands of matte boxes that fit the 4 x 5.65” standard. The cinema filters also conform with the 4mm thickness allowing them to fit into filter cages or slot into cageless designs. A leatherette pouch is included for storage and transport.
